765

4 分钟

#Python 的容器类型

在编程中,我们经常需要存储、操作和管理多个数据项,创建一大堆变量显然不合适。
Python 提供了一系列 容器(Container) 类型,它们可以存放多个元素,并提供灵活的操作方式。

容器类型说明访问查找插入(末尾)插入删除(末尾)删除内存
元组(tuple)有序数据的 不可变 集合O(1)O(n)----连续、较少
列表(list)有序数据的 可变 集合O(1)O(n)O(1)O(n)O(1)O(n)连续、较少
字典(dict)键值对映射结构O(1)O(1)O(1)O(1)O(1)O(1)不连续、较多
集合(set)无序的唯一元素的集合O(1)O(1)O(1)O(1)O(1)O(1)不连续、较多
  • 同为 O(1) 的操作,元组和列表比字典和集合更快。

创建于 2025/4/10

更新于 2025/6/9